A few problems solved

I met with Doug (GC) and Lonnie (owner of framing company). Reviewed a few issues: a.) there were a few 6’8” doors on main floor, but the rest were 8’. Doug thought this would look funny, I agreed; changing all first floor doors to 8’0” and all second floor doors to 7’0”.  b.) reviewed stairs- upper stairs will be all open, stairs to basement will be closed (wall between the two flights), all stairs will be solid hardwood with a carpet runner on top. c.) concrete walls on entry are a bit confusing. Lonnie and Doug figured out a solution. It looks like the architect plans and structural plans don’t match entirely, but they will frame it out, center the door, etc. and make it look right.  Seeing Doug working with the subs to solve these types of problems makes me appreciate the role of the GC.  

They may frame the basement tomorrow if they have downtime since the steel for the second floor won’t arrive until Wednesday.

Doug also said that raising the Frigidaire frig/freezer to the height of the toe kick should work fine. He just did it in a hi-end custom home in Boulder (the owner was really tall and wanted everything higher).

BTW, views line up perfectly from the great room window. Awesome.
